Strengthening westerlies to reduce thunderstorms over leeward TN
As we often mention monsoon dynamics is an oscillating pendulum. Very rarely one can see it an equilibrium state. Depending on atmospheric support the movement of pendulum may be fast or slow. When monsoon winds weaken from the west along with break in monsoon thunderstorms improve over leeward plains of TN. When strengthening westerly winds…
Window of thunderstorms for North Coastal TN
Over the past few days as Southwest Monsoon slowed a window of thunderstorms opened for the leeward plains of TN. Widespread thunderstorms pushed the seasonal rainfall performance for TN & PDC from -11% to 3%. The last 5 days have contributed nearly 30 mm to the seasonal rainfall tally over TN & PDC. But in…
